gpt4 book ai didi

javascript - 双击事件在选项列表的 Internet Explorer 中不起作用

转载 作者:搜寻专家 更新时间:2023-10-31 08:47:32 25 4
gpt4 key购买 nike

HTML 代码:

<select name="options" id="options" style="width: 100%;" size="12">
<option id="optList1" value="1">
1. ABC
</option>
</select>

Javascript:

document.getElementById('optList1').ondblclick = function () {
alert("asf");
};

我在选择中列出了选项,在样本中只有一项。问题是我需要在双击此选项时打开对话框...它在 Chrome 和 Firefox 中工作正常,问题很常见,在 IE 中不工作...

DEMO

非常感谢任何帮助...在此先感谢...!!

最佳答案

document.getElementById('options').ondblclick = function () {
var optio = options.options;
var id = options[options.selectedIndex].id;
if(id == "optList1")
{
alert("abc");
}
else
{
alert("xyz")
}
};


<select name="options" id="options" style="width: 100%;" size="12">
<option id="optList1" value="1.1">
2. Enter/Update W/H Data Manually
</option>
<option id="optList2" value="1.1">
1. Enter/Update W/H Data Manually
</option>

试试这段代码,它在 IE 上运行良好

关于javascript - 双击事件在选项列表的 Internet Explorer 中不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14521863/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com